APWU OF FLORIDA STATE RETIREE CHAPTER SPRING EVENTS!

An APWU of Florida State Retiree Chapter Dutch treat luncheon is to be held in Lakeland, Fl. from 11:30 a.m.-1:00 p.m. on Friday, March 21, 2003, at the Four Points Sheraton Hotel Restaurant, 4141 South Florida Ave. 33813 to celebrate our good fortunes in being APWU alive! John R. Smith, Director, National APWU Retiree Dept., is our invited guest speaker, and he will address 2003 retiree issues for APWU active postal workers who are still employed by USPS and APWU retirees with Q & A.

All active and retired APWU members, Auxiliary, and family/guests are invited to attend this luncheon to renew old acquaintances and meet new friends. Free APWU Retiree Happy folders will be given to all attendees. Dream a little and become part of the action!

The APWU of Florida Spring Seminar occurs Thurs., March 20 thru Sat. March 22, 2003 at the same hotel, and this creates a wonderful opportunity for the active stewards and officers of Area Local/Local unions to meet and talk with APWU Retirees who fought the battles to form our great labor organization in the 60’s, 70’s, 80’s, 90’s, and 00’s. We are looking forward to reminiscing with APWU active members and Retirees in Lakeland!

All 2376 APWU of Florida Retirees who pay $24.00 year National APWU Retiree union dues are now being mailed their personal copy of the Florida Postal Worker monthly, thanks to the actions by the APWU of Florida State Retiree Chapter Executive Board at the Retiree Convention in May, 2002 and the APWU of Florida Executive Board approval in September, 2002, led by President Martha Shunn-King.
Thanks to George Curcio, Editor, Florida Postal Worker, for his help. Drop a note to George if you enjoy reading the award winning newsletter. Let the good times roll and share your inspirations with other APWU survivors. If you move, mail him your old and new address!

Tony Fransetta, President, Florida Alliance for Retired Americans (FLARA), has announced a scheduled FLARA Legislative Conference and Executive Board meeting to be held in Tallahassee, Fl. to commence on Monday, March 17 and Tuesday, March 18, 2003 at the Ramada Inn Tallahassee, 2900 North Monroe Street in Tallahassee, Fl. 32303.
The historic conclave has been called to discuss and layout plans for action in the Spring Session of the Florida Legislature. Legislative resolutions will be taken up, debated, and approved on Monday, and scheduled meetings with Florida legislators will occur on Tuesday with reports back to the Conference later.

Jack Gose, President, will represent the APWU of Florida State Retiree Chapter and looks for the turnout of other APWU activists and APWU Retirees at this event. Jack is an elected Executive Board member of FLARA which meets quarterly around the state.

All FLARA Executive Board members, Club and individual members, and invited family/guests are welcome at this exciting annual gathering to foster support for the important issues that face Florida Union Retirees and seniors, including affordable prescription drugs. A banquet luncheon is set up for noon on Monday, March 17.

The Legislative Conference registration fee is $80.00 and guest registration is $60.00. Contact Janelle Thomas, Office Manager and Membership Director of FLARA, located in West Palm Beach area at 1-561-792-8799 if you are interested or have any questions or comments.

Ramada Inn Tallahassee hotel room rate is $74.00 plus 10 % tax per night for FLARA members and guests. Call the Ramada Inn in Tallahassee, Fl. at 1-850-386-1027 to make reservations, and ask for the FLARA special group rate. All roads lead to Tallahassee for FLARA/APWU Retiree Actions now!!
